If former University of New Mexico football star Brian Urlacher gets drafted by the Chicago Bears this Saturday at No. 9, the money will be more than fine.

If he goes to the Arizona Cardinals at No. 7, call it a greener slice of heaven.

And if he's selected by a team trading up to No. 5, Urlacher may be able to buy himself a small country.
